7. Role Requirements & Qualifications

A strong candidate for this role possesses both the technical agility to solve complex problems and the professional maturity to work within a large-scale engineering organization.

  • Must-have skills: Proficiency in at least one major programming language (e.g., Python, C++, or Java), experience with database management, and a strong understanding of version control systems like Git.
  • Nice-to-have skills: Experience with cloud infrastructure (AWS/Azure), familiarity with industrial automation protocols, and previous exposure to data visualization tools.
  • Experience: A solid foundation in software engineering, with a preference for candidates who have worked on complex, data-heavy systems or in industrial environments.

9. Other General Tips

  • Structure your answers: Use the STAR method (Situation, Task, Action, Result) when answering behavioral questions to ensure your responses are concise and impactful.
  • Show your work: When solving a technical problem, verbalize your thought process. Interviewers are more interested in how you approach a problem than in whether you reach the "perfect" answer instantly.
  • Research the projects: Familiarize yourself with the core sectors CIMIC Group operates in; showing interest in the company’s actual output demonstrates genuine engagement.
  • Ask meaningful questions: Use the end of your interview to ask about the team’s current technical challenges or the company’s approach to innovation.

How many rounds is the CIMIC Group Software Engineer interview process?
Candidates report 3 stages: Initial Screening, Technical Interviews, and Behavioral Assessment. The interview process section above breaks down what each stage covers.
How much does a Software Engineer at CIMIC Group make?
Reported compensation for Software Engineer roles at CIMIC Group ranges from roughly $84k base to $153k total per year, varying by level, team, and location.
